Drum Machine Donca Matic DE-20 (Historic Drum machine anno 1966, Keio-Electric Lab later renamed Korg)

One of the first drum machines manufactured by Keio-Electric Lab in Tokyo/Japan, the analogue Donca Matic DE-20 is featured in some rare articles available online. It is well working and producing its clear and solid sound with good bass volume.

For years, there have been no available units of this series on the market. Korg today exhibits examples in its in-house museum in Tokyo.The DE-20 is sold from a smoke-free private studio to collectors, bands, or museums. It presumably comes from the estate of the legendary Musicland Studio in Munich, though this cannot be reliably confirmed.

Here in the studio, it was used for demo recordings and once in a music performance in Schwabing/Munich in the early 2000s. The DE-20 was generally intended to replace the drummer in small bands, musician duos or dance events.
